Summary
Primary closure of abdominal wall defects improves survival rates and reduces hospital stays for patients with gastroschisis and omphalocele. Long-term outcomes are generally good, though gastroesophageal reflux (GER) is common.

Background:
- Survival rates for abdominal wall defects have improved due to advancements in treatment.
- Gastroschisis and omphalocele are common congenital conditions requiring surgical intervention.
Purpose of the Study:
- To review treatment modalities for abdominal wall defects.
- To analyze the long-term outcomes of patients with gastroschisis and omphalocele.
- To compare primary closure with the silo technique for abdominal wall defects.
Main Methods:
- Meta-analysis of English clinical studies from 1953-1998.
- Searched Medline for "abdominal wall defects", "gastroschisis", and "omphalocele or exomphalos".
Main Results:
- Primary closure, when feasible without compromise, leads to better survival rates, lower sepsis risk, and shorter hospital stays.
- No significant differences were observed in oral feeding resumption, parenteral nutrition duration, or ventilatory support between primary and silo techniques.
- Long-term outcomes are generally favorable, with a high incidence of gastroesophageal reflux (GER) noted.
Conclusions:
- Primary closure is the preferred operative management for abdominal wall defects when hemodynamically stable.
- Patients require regular follow-up due to the high prevalence of GER.
- Advances in treatment have significantly improved patient outcomes for these congenital defects.
